      <description>From my reseller tech support;&lt;BR /&gt;
&lt;BR /&gt;
It is there. Someone had the idea to split the Migration Libraries into 2 separate folders. Look inside the ArchiCAD 18 folder for&lt;BR /&gt;
-  "ArchiCAD Migration Libraries" (contains  libraries 13 thru 17) and &lt;BR /&gt;
-  "Old ArchiCAD Migration Libraries" (contains libraries 10 thru 12)</description>

I think you  might be skipping a step in the migration process. When opening the old file in AC18 you should get a Library dialog box asking if you want to consolidate libraries. Select yes and AC should process the file and update or link libraries as needed. I think that the reason that some windows and doors don't migrate is to avoid losing information like Dimensions and/or Labels or schedule settings.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;IMG src="https://community.graphisoft.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/13289i809E3B40F894ED7F/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" border="0" alt="Screen Shot 2015-02-15 at 10.28.05 AM.png" title="Screen Shot 2015-02-15 at 10.28.05 AM.png" /&gt;</description>
